History and Cultural Significance



The roots of Peshawari chappal go back centuries, deeply connected with the traditions of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a. It was originally designed for durability and comfort in rough terrains, allowing locals to walk long distances with ease. Over time, this footwear gained popularity in urban areas and became a cultural icon. Today, it is worn not only in Pakistan but also admired internationally for its traditional appeal and unique style.



Design and Craftsmanship



One of the most defining features of a Peshawari chappal is its distinctive design. It typically includes a closed toe, multiple straps, and a sturdy sole made from high-quality leather. The handcrafted nature of these chappals ensures attention to detail, from precise stitching to strong finishing. Skilled artisans spend hours perfecting each pair, ensuring that the final product is both stylish and long-lasting. The use of natural materials also enhances breathability and comfort.



Comfort and Durability



Comfort is a major reason why Peshawari chappal remains a preferred choice for many people. The soft leather adapts to the shape of the foot over time, providing a custom fit. The thick sole offers support and reduces pressure on the feet, making it suitable for long wear. Additionally, these chappals are known for their durability, often lasting for years if properly maintained. This combination of comfort and longevity makes them a practical investment.
